Understanding Tensile Roofing Solutions
A tensile structure is simply a roof built using a special membrane that is held tightly in position by steel cables. What makes them special is how they handle force: they work best when they are stretched tight (under tension). They are easy to make in advance, can cover huge spaces, and are very flexible.
This building system uses minimal materials because it relies on thin, strong canvases. When these thin canvases are pulled taut by steel cables, they become surfaces that are powerful enough to overcome any forces acting against them.
These structures are essentially lightweight fabric shields, designed specifically to guard buildings against rain, sun, and other weather. The project needs to determine the choice of fabric, which could be PTFE, HDPE, or flexible PVC. The fabric is then pulled tight over metal frames (steel or aluminum) to create protective features that also look great.
Traditional roofing: The Conventional Approach
Traditional roofs use common materials like concrete, metal sheets, tiles, or asphalt shingles, depending on the structure and budget. These roofs are usually heavier and more complex because they require rigid, compressed support structures to remain stable. While traditional roofs have been reliable for decades, they often fall short in modern projects that demand sustainability, quick building times, and innovative design.
Tensile vs Traditional: A Detailed Comparison
| Feature | Tensile Roofs | Traditional Roofs |
| Weight | Uses light materials like fabric membranes and steel frameworks, decreasing the burden on support structures. Perfect for extensive or upgraded projects. | Made from heavy materials like tiles, slate, or concrete, requiring reinforced supports that increase structural demands and costs. |
| Design Flexibility | Can be shaped into unique shapes like curves, cones, and striking arcs. Provide limitless creative opportunities for architects and designers. | Limited to conventional types such as flat, sloped, or gabled roofs, limiting architectural innovation. |
| Installation Efficiency | Prefabricated components allow faster, less labor-intensive installation, minimizing project timelines and costs. | Installation involves multiple layers and complex processes, leading to longer timelines and higher labor requirements. |
| Aesthetic Appeal | Modern, sleek, and visually striking. Improves the architectural character of an area and fosters open, well-lit settings. | Focuses on functionality but often lacks distinctive or eye-catching design features. |
| Maintenance | Needs little maintenance due to strong materials that withstand corrosion and weather effects. | Needs regular inspections, repairs, and occasional replacements due to wear and tear. |
